> Half of the information in the raddb is outdated and erroneous.

While there is a great deal of old data that is obsolete, we use the
RADB to configure our routers and also for peering via the route
servers and find few problems that impact operations.

I do suspect that a "sunset" clause will be needed some day to clear
out old cruft.
